
Mastering Web Development: A Strategic Guide for Modern Digital Success
Web development is the backbone of the modern digital economy, serving as the bridge between raw code and user experience. Whether you are building a simple landing page or a complex, data-heavy enterprise application, understanding the fundamental principles of development is essential. It is more than just writing syntax; it is about creating efficient, secure, and scalable environments that solve real-world business problems effectively.
For organizations looking to establish a robust digital presence, the approach to development must be both practical and forward-thinking. By focusing on modular architecture, clean code practices, and user-centric design, businesses can ensure their digital tools remain relevant as the industry evolves. You can learn more about professional approaches to digital growth by visiting https://carlosarner.com to explore additional resources and insights.
Understanding the Core Components of Web Development
Modern development is typically categorized into three distinct pillars: front-end, back-end, and full-stack development. Front-end development focuses on the client-side experience, utilizing technologies like HTML, CSS, and JavaScript frameworks to create interactive interfaces. It is the visual layer that users interact with directly, meaning that responsiveness and accessibility are the primary performance indicators for this area of development.
On the other hand, back-end development involves everything that happens behind the scenes, including server management, database architecture, and API integration. Without a robust back-end, even the most polished interface would be non-functional, as there would be no way to store data or process user requests. Developers must ensure these two sides communicate seamlessly through well-documented APIs to maintain high performance and data integrity.
Key Features and Capabilities for Modern Projects
When planning a development project, it is vital to prioritize features that drive business outcomes rather than just adding complexity. Scalability is perhaps the most important capability to consider, as it ensures your application can handle increased traffic without compromising speed. Similarly, robust security protocols—such as end-to-end encryption and regular security patching—are non-negotiable in an era where data privacy is a top priority for users and regulators alike.
Another essential feature is the integration of automation within the development workflow. By utilizing CI/CD pipelines and automated testing, teams can ship features faster while significantly reducing the margin for human error. This systematic approach allows developers to focus on creative problem-solving rather than repetitive manual tasks, leading to higher-quality code and a more sustainable software lifecycle.
| Approach | Primary Focus | Scalability | Ideal For |
|---|---|---|---|
| Monolithic | Unified codebase | Low to Medium | Early-stage startups |
| Microservices | Modular services | High | Enterprise applications |
| Serverless | Event-driven functions | Highest | Rapidly shifting workloads |
Common Use Cases for Web Development Services
Web development serves a wide array of business needs, ranging from simple information portals to complex transactional platforms. One common use case is the creation of custom e-commerce environments, where the focus is on conversion optimization, payment gateway integration, and inventory synchronization. These systems require a high level of reliability, as downtime or slow load times can translate directly to revenue loss.
Another frequent application is the development of internal business dashboards. These tools allow companies to visualize data streams, monitor KPIs, and automate administrative tasks. Because these platforms are often used by employees daily, user experience design and intuitive workflows become just as important as the underlying database speed. Ultimately, the use case dictates the tech stack and the infrastructural strategy that the development team will employ.
Evaluating Pricing and Investment Factors
Investment in web development is rarely a fixed cost, as it fluctuates based on project complexity, team expertise, and maintenance requirements. While off-the-shelf solutions may seem cheaper initially, they often lack the custom features necessary to support long-term growth. It is important to view development costs as an operational investment that includes not only the initial build but also the ongoing updates, security audits, and cloud infrastructure fees.
Companies should look for transparency in pricing and clear documentation regarding what is included in the project scope. Hidden costs often emerge during the integration phase or when moving from a staging environment to a production server. By clearly defining technical requirements and project milestones upfront, organizations can prevent scope creep and ensure that their budget is allocated to high-impact features that provide genuine business value.
Ensuring Reliability, Security, and Support
Reliability in web development is achieved through rigorous testing, redundant infrastructure, and proactive monitoring tools. A reliable system is one that can handle unexpected failures without impacting the end user, often employing load balancing and failover protocols. Security must be baked into the development lifecycle from day one, rather than treated as an afterthought; this includes secure coding standards, input validation, and protection against common vulnerabilities like SQL injection.
Equally critical is the level of technical support provided after the launch. Whether you are using a managed service provider or an in-house team, having a clear channel for troubleshooting and performance optimization is essential. Consistent support ensures that as your user base grows or your business requirements change, your digital infrastructure is capable of Adapting without requiring a complete system overhaul.
Best Practices for Successful Workflow Integration
To maximize the efficiency of a development project, teams should adopt a workflow that prioritizes visibility and communication. Implementing Agile methodologies, such as Scrum or Kanban, allows stakeholders to monitor progress during regular sprints and provide feedback early in the process. This iterative cycle helps prevent the misalignment between business goals and final deliverables often seen in prolonged waterfall project models.
- Define clear project goals before starting any code.
- Use version control systems (like Git) to manage changes and collaboration.
- Document architecture and API endpoints for future scalability.
- Prioritize mobile responsiveness and cross-browser compatibility.
- Conduct regular performance audits to address latency issues.
Choosing the Right Development Strategy
Deciding on a development strategy involves balancing your immediate business needs with your long-term vision. For many businesses, a hybrid approach—incorporating pre-built components for standard functions and custom development for core intellectual property—offers the best balance of time-to-market and unique competitive advantage. Before starting, evaluate your team’s existing skill sets, the necessity for third-party integrations, and your projected scalability requirements over the next three to five years.
As the digital landscape becomes increasingly saturated, the quality of your web development will differentiate you from the competition. Focus on building a resilient, fast, and user-friendly platform that serves your customers’ needs while remaining agile enough to pivot when market conditions change. By investing in the right tools and fostering a disciplined development culture, you can build a sustainable digital asset that serves as a cornerstone for your organizational success.






